Translation guide
The English verb "confer" has two main meanings: to discuss or consult with others, and to bestow or grant something. This guide covers natural Japanese expressions for each.
To have a discussion, exchange opinions, or consult with someone, often in a formal or deliberative context.
The most common and versatile word for consulting or discussing something with someone. Suitable for both formal and informal situations.
その件について上司と相談します。
I will confer with my boss about that matter.
More formal than 相談する, often used for official or business discussions to reach a decision.
To give or grant something such as an honor, title, or right, often in a formal or official manner.
The standard word for formally conferring an award, degree, or honor. Used in official ceremonies.
大学は彼に名誉学位を授与した。
The university conferred an honorary degree on him.
English 'confer' can mean either 'discuss' or 'bestow'. In Japanese, these are expressed with completely different verbs. Make sure to choose the right one based on context.
相談する is often used with the particle に for the person consulted and について for the topic. It can also be used as a noun: 相談 (consultation).
